Got Wood? Want to Alaia?





We got busy on a flat Day and made a new Alaia for the Demo Range at the Shop. this one is made of Paulonia and measures 6'6"x16 1/2"x 3/4". perfect for most average size surfers. these pics are taken just before Jamie took it out for a christening! He came back from surfing in front of the shop at Tugun with smiles ear to ear. catching waves that you would struggle to get any sort of joy on with a normal board.

Hands up for the DK8-Kwad in Indo



Dave and I have been working on a few new concepts and testing them in the waves where I live in Bali, Indonesia. On Dave’s recent trip to Bali we worked closely on fine tuning a board design that would be suitable for a broad range of conditions. The development we have been working on from last year. The idea is to come up with a single board that is light and maneuverable in small beach break waves while maintaining integral strength and function for riding medium to large size waves over reef. We are getting close to perfecting this design and we tested a few boards at various locations on the island, trying to get a real feel for each board to discover both the positive and negative attributes. the DK8 is our result... This is a 6'2" roundtail DK at Belangan. We surfed this board in small 1-2 foot beachbreaks then right up to this day at Belangan... ALL ROUND BOARD...! 10/10.
